Girls Golf Hosts Two At Eagles Nest This Week

Posted on: September 9, 2018

SETTING THE SCENE: With the Eastern Cincinnati Conference Tournament quickly approaching, the Milford High School girls golf team will continue its 2018 slate with a pair of matches at Eagles Nest Golf Course this week. The Eagles split a pair of dual matches last week and enter the week with a 5-3 record in head-to-head contests this fall. The ECC championship event is slated for Thursday, Sept. 20 at Walden Ponds Golf Course.

 

THE UPCOMING DOCKET: A look at Milford’s schedule for the upcoming week:

  • Monday, Sept. 10 vs. Wyoming, Eagles Nest Golf Course, 4:00 p.m.
  • Thursday, Sept. 13 vs. Kings, Eagles Nest Golf Course, 4:00 p.m.

 

A LOOK BACK: Sept. 4 vs. Turpin: A match-up of two of the top teams in the ECC went to Turpin as the Spartans scored a 174-185 victory at Deer Track Golf Course. Senior Bre Severns was the top player on the day for Milford, finishing with a score of 45.

 

Sept. 6 vs. Little Miami: Milford enjoyed a runaway win at Eagles Nest Golf Course, bettering Little Miami by a 182-251 margin. Senior Morgan Clawson earned medalist honors for the event with a round of 39.

 

INSIDE THE NUMBERS: A look at Milford’s individual averages for the 2018 season:

  • Megan Loux (46.5—ranked 9th in ECC)
  • Abi Loux (47.4)
  • Alexis Crowell (48.8)
  • Bre Severns (50.0)
  • Morgan Clawson (51.8)
  • Megan LaFrance (51.8)

 

POLL WATCH: Milford continues to receive votes in the weekly Cincinnati Enquirer area coaches’ poll, released on Sept. 10. Lakota East and Mason share the No. 1 spot again this week, with the former taking four first place votes, to seven for the latter. Third place Ursuline and fourth place Sycamore each picked up a first place vote, with Mercy McAuley rounding out the top-five. Representing the ECC are Kings in eighth, Turpin in a tie for 10th and Loveland and Anderson also in others receiving votes. The coaches’ poll is released every Monday at Noon at preps.cincinnati.com/coachespolls.

 

SEVERNS WINS ENQUIRER AWARD: Senior Bre Severns, thanks to the support of Eagle Nation, was voted the winner of the Cincinnati Enquirer’s Golfer of the Week Award, announced on Sept. 7.
